How to Replace a Cat Flap: A Step-by-Step Guide

Changing a cat flap is a fairly simple DIY job that can be completed with basic tools and materials. Here's a detailed guide:

Materials required:
A new cat flapScrewdriver or drillDetermining tapePencil or markerWood screws (if essential)Weatherstripping (if needed)
Instructions:
Measure the existing cat flap: Measure the width and height of the existing cat flap to ensure that the new one fits perfectly.Eliminate the old cat flap: Use a screwdriver or drill to remove the screws holding the old cat flap in place. Gently pry the cat flap out of the door or wall.Tidy the location: Clean the area around the old cat flap to remove any particles or dirt.Mark the position of the new cat flap: Use a pencil or marker to mark the position of the brand-new cat flap on the door or wall.Drill pilot holes: Drill pilot holes for the screws that will hold the new cat flap in place.Install the brand-new cat flap: Insert the brand-new cat flap into the door or wall and screw it into place.Include weatherstripping (if essential): Apply weatherstripping around the edges of the cat flap to prevent drafts and leaks.
